Abstract  Abstract

A method for hiding frame erasures caused by frames of an encoded sound signal deleted during transmission from an encoder (700) to a decoder (300) and for recovering the decoder (300) after frame erasures, the procedure comprising: in the encoder (700), the determination (707) of the concealment / recovery parameters, including at least phase information related to the frames of the encoded sound signal, in which the phase information comprises a pulse position (Γq ) glottic in each frame of the encoded sound signal, determined by measuring (707) the glottic pulse (Γq) as a pulse of maximum amplitude in a predetermined fundamental frequency cycle of the frame of the encoded sound signal and determining (707) the position of the pulse of maximum amplitude; transmit (213) to the decoder (300) the concealment / recovery parameters determined in the encoder (700); and in the decoder (300), perform a frame erase concealment in response to the received concealment / recovery parameters, in which the frame erase concealment comprises resynchronizing (900), in response to the received phase information, the frames whose deletion is hidden with the corresponding frames of the sound signal encoded in the encoder (700); characterized in that that resynchronization of a frame whose deletion is hidden with a corresponding frame of the encoded sound signal comprises: decoding (910) the position of the glottic pulse (Γq) of said frame of the encoded sound signal; determining (912), in the frame whose deletion is hidden, a position of a pulse of maximum amplitude closer to the position of said glottic pulse (Γq) of said corresponding frame of said encoded sound signal; and align (920) the position of the maximum amplitude set in the frame whose deletion is hidden with the position of the glottic pulse (Γq) of the corresponding frame of the encoded sound signal.
